Understanding Glue Heating Solutions
In the manufacturing sector, the efficiency of adhesive application is critical to ensuring product quality and production speed. **Glue heating solutions** are specialized systems designed to heat adhesives to their optimal application temperature. This is crucial as the viscosity of glue often affects its performance. Heating adhesives enables smoother application and enhances bonding strength, ensuring that manufacturing processes are seamless and efficient.

Types of Glue Heating Systems
Understanding the various types of glue heating systems available can help manufacturers make informed decisions about which solution best fits their needs.
1. Hot Melt Glue Systems
Hot melt adhesive systems use heated adhesive that melts and is applied in liquid form. They are versatile and suitable for a range of applications, making them popular in packaging and woodworking.
**Benefits:** Quick setting times, strong bonding capabilities, and minimal waste.
2. Electric Glue Heating Systems
These systems use electric heaters to maintain the desired adhesive temperature. They offer precise temperature control and can accommodate various adhesive types.
**Benefits:** Energy-efficient operation and ease of use.
3. Infrared Glue Heating Systems
Infrared heating systems utilize radiant heat to warm the adhesive. This method is highly efficient and effective for specific applications where direct heat application is beneficial.
**Benefits:** Uniform heating and reduced heat loss.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What factors should I consider when choosing a glue heating system?
Consider adhesive type, application method, production volume, and energy efficiency when selecting a glue heating system.
2. How can I improve the efficiency of my existing glue heating system?
Regular maintenance, implementing temperature control devices, and training staff can enhance your current system's efficiency.
3. Are there any safety concerns with glue heating systems?
Yes, safety concerns include burns and adhesive fumes. Proper training and equipment can mitigate these risks.
4. How does heating glue affect its properties?
Heating glue reduces its viscosity, allowing for smoother application and stronger bonding once set.
5. What is the average lifespan of a glue heating system?
The lifespan can vary significantly based on usage and maintenance, but many systems last 5-10 years with proper care.
